Ensuring safer care for every newborn

This year’s World Patient Safety Day, organised by the World Health Organisation, shines a spotlight on the critical importance of safety from the very beginning of life.  

Health Innovation South West has been supporting innovation enabling safer care for babies, before, during, and after hospital.  

 

Safer care before hospital  

Babies born unexpectedly at home, in a car or in an ambulance, before arrival at hospital, are at risk of hypothermia.  

We launched a project to look at the circumstances around these births, to understand which women were most at risk of giving birth before arriving at hospital and the type of advice on neonatal temperature management given to callers who ring 999 about a baby born before hospital. 

The project, led by Laura Goodwin, Associate Professor in Emergency Care at the University of West of England, has yielded learning in neonatal temperature management for UK emergency care that is already being implemented in the South West and taught to paramedics across England.

Safer care during hospital 

In hospitals, managing deterioration in babies and children is a long-standing challenge for patient safety.  

Martha’s Rule is a major new initiative to improve the management of deteriorating patients, including babies and children. 

All staff, patients, families and carers can promptly raise concerns if they notice changes in a child’s condition, and escalate them through structured conversations and 24-hour access to an urgent review.  

Our South West Patient Safety Collaborative has worked closely with four acute NHS trusts in the South West to test and implement Martha’s Rule as part of the National Patient Safety Improvement Programmes. Martha’s Rule has since become available in all acute hospitals across the country, NHS England announced last week.  

Meanwhile, another patient safety tool is helping recognise newborn deterioration early. The National Early Warning Trigger and Track (NEWTT2) framework charts vital signs and sets out clear escalation pathways to empower staff at every level to raise concerns about newborns and make sure action is taken in the right timeframe. 

Fergal O’ Malley, Clinical Associate in Perinatal Patient Safety at Health Innovation South West and Advanced Neonatal Nurse Practitioner, works as part of the team providing care for families at Royal Cornwall Hospitals NHS Trust. Fergal has witnessed firsthand the impact of this tool. 

“In Cornwall, the introduction of NEWTT2 is helping to keep babies safer during the postnatal period. The tool provides a clear structure for capturing vital information, supporting staff to spot early signs of deterioration and act quickly to prevent infants from becoming unwell.”  

The NEWTT2 tool has been recently updated to recognise the concern of parents and the vital role of families’ observations alongside the wider care team.  

Says Fergal: “The result is safer care for babies, and less separation between newborns and their parents at a critical time.” 

In babies born prematurely before 34 weeks, a bundle of 11 evidence-based interventions known as PERIPrem (Perinatal Excellence to Reduce Injury in Premature Birth), can reduce brain injury and mortality rates.  

The PERIPrem bundle was launched by Health Innovation South West and Health Innovation West of England in 2020 in partnership with the South West Neonatal Network.  

There’s been national interest and spread since its successful implementation and evaluation in South West England, where maternity units have achieved the lowest mortality rate for babies born at less than 32 weeks’ gestation (NNAP, October 2024).   

“PERIPrem, as a QI project, has had the greatest impact I’ve seen in 10 years at Torbay and South Devon.”   

Dr Richard Tozer, Consultant Paediatrician, Torbay and South Devon NHS Foundation Trust 

 

Safer care after hospital 

For newborn babies showing early signs of an infection, an innovative new project is enabling their parents to take them home sooner.   

NOAH (Neonatal Oral Antibiotics at Home) enables eligible newborns with suspected early onset infection to switch from IV antibiotics in hospital to oral antibiotics at home after 36 hours of treatment.  

The innovative approach is moving newborn care from hospital to home – a shift particularly important in a rural region like South West England, where families face long travel distances to hospitals and other neonatal care services.    

Emily, Harry, and their young daughter Luna, from rural Woodbury, Devon, are one of the families to benefit. Emily was shown how to administer antibiotics to Luna at home.   

“To be able to come home with antibiotics for Luna during my first few days as a mum made all the difference for us as a family”, says Emily. “It meant we could be together, and I’m so grateful for that precious time as a family.”   

NOAH was awarded Best Local Project at the 2025 British Association of Perinatal Medicine Gopi Menon Awards last week.  

 

Supporting safer maternity care for every newborn and every child  

The Health Innovation Network is commissioned by NHS England to host the 15 Patient Safety Collaboratives, via the local health innovation networks – including Health Innovation South West. Our role is to support NHS organisations to adopt safety interventions and strategies, aligned with the National Patient Safety Plan.   

By hosting the 15 Patient Safety Collaboratives, the Health Innovation Network is working with all 134 maternity and neonatal providers in England to reduce the rates of maternal and neonatal deaths, stillbirths and brain injuries that occur during or soon after birth, via the Maternity and Neonatal Safety Improvement Programme (MatNeoSIP) 

To date this programme of work has saved up to 1,692 lives, prevented 554 cases of cerebral palsy and supported almost 100 organisations to implement tools which improve the early recognition of deterioration of women and babies, leading to timely escalation.   

And because of this work, 708 babies have avoided Strep B, 1,692 babies survived because of receiving the care bundles and 313 babies survived due to antenatal steroids and 1,202 babies survived due to optimal cord management.
